Add EGL_ANGLE_vulkan_image extension This extension is for exporting VkImage from EGLImage. The VkImage must be used with the same VkDevice used by ANGLE Vulkan backend. // ImageVk.h:
// Defines the class interface for ImageVk, implementing ImageImpl.
//
#ifndef LIBANGLE_RENDERER_VULKAN_IMAGEVK_H_
#define LIBANGLE_RENDERER_VULKAN_IMAGEVK_H_
#include "libANGLE/renderer/ImageImpl.h"
#include "libANGLE/renderer/vulkan/vk_helpers.h"
namespace rx
{
class ExternalImageSiblingVk : public ExternalImageSiblingImpl
{
public:
ExternalImageSiblingVk() {}
~ExternalImageSiblingVk() override {}
virtual vk::ImageHelper *getImage() const = 0;
virtual void release(RendererVk *renderer) = 0;
};
class ImageVk : public ImageImpl
{
public:
ImageVk(const egl::ImageState &state, const gl::Context *context);
~ImageVk() override;
void onDestroy(const egl::Display *display) override;
egl::Error initialize(const egl::Display *display) override;
angle::Result orphan(const gl::Context *context, egl::ImageSibling *sibling) override;
egl::Error exportVkImage(void *vkImage, void *vkImageCreateInfo) override;
vk::ImageHelper *getImage() const { return mImage; }
gl::TextureType getImageTextureType() const { return mImageTextureType; }
gl::LevelIndex getImageLevel() const { return mImageLevel; }
uint32_t getImageLayer() const { return mImageLayer; }
private:
gl::TextureType mImageTextureType;
gl::LevelIndex mImageLevel;
uint32_t mImageLayer;
bool mOwnsImage;
vk::ImageHelper *mImage;
std::vector<vk::Shared<vk::Fence>> mImageLastUseFences;
const gl::Context *mContext;
};
} // namespace rx
#endif // LIBANGLE_RENDERER_VULKAN_IMAGEVK_H_
